• Stars
    star
    150
  • Rank 247,323 (Top 5 %)
  • Language
    Shell
  • License
    MIT License
  • Created over 13 years ago
  • Updated over 4 years 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

This is just a set of scripts to rebuild a known working kernel for ARM devices.

Script Bugs: "[email protected]"

Note, for older git tag's please use: https://github.com/RobertCNelson/yakbuild

Dependencies: GCC ARM Cross ToolChain

Linaro: http://www.linaro.org/downloads/

Dependencies: Linux Kernel Source

This git repo contains just scripts/patches to build a specific kernel for some ARM devices. The kernel source will be downloaded when you run any of the build scripts.

By default this script will clone the linux-stable tree: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ux-stable.git to: ${DIR}/ignore/linux-src:

If you've already cloned torvalds tree and would like to save some hard drive space, just modify the LINUX_GIT variable in system.sh to point to your current git clone directory.

Build Kernel Image:

./build_kernel.sh

Optional: Build Debian Package:

./build_deb.sh

Development/Hacking:

first run (to setup baseline tree): ./build_kernel.sh then modify files under KERNEL directory then run (to rebuild with your changes): ./tools/rebuild.sh

More Repositories

1

omap-image-builder

omap image builder
Shell
146
star
2

bb-kernel

133
star
3

boot-scripts

Just a bunch of useful scripts placed under /opt/scripts/
Shell
125
star
4

ti-linux-kernel-dev

vendor bsp...
Shell
87
star
5

u-boot

mirror of git://git.denx.de/u-boot.git
C
85
star
6

netinstall

Network Install for a bunch of arm boards
Shell
79
star
7

armv7-multiplatform

75
star
8

stable-kernel

Shell
74
star
9

tools

small collection of scripts that end up on the ARM images...
Shell
53
star
10

dtb-rebuilder

C
52
star
11

bb.org-overlays

Device Tree Overlays for bb.org boards
Shell
38
star
12

Bootloader-Builder

create sanity in the insanity
C
29
star
13

armv7-lpae-multiplatform

20
star
14

linux-stable-rcn-ee

C
16
star
15

ti-linux-kernel

mirror of:
C
11
star
16

dtc

Mirror of: https://git.kernel.org/pub/scm/utils/dtc/dtc.git
C
10
star
17

barebox

mirror of: git://git.pengutronix.de/git/barebox.git
C
9
star
18

armv5_devel

Shell
9
star
19

imx-devel

Abandoned use: https://github.com/RobertCNelson/armv7-multiplatform
Shell
9
star
20

device-tree-rebasing

mirror: https://git.kernel.org/cgit/linux/kernel/git/devicetree/devicetree-rebasing.git/
C
9
star
21

ti-sdk-pvr

C
8
star
22

Supercon-2017-PocketBeagle

Shell
8
star
23

yakbuild

Yet Another Kernel BUILD script
Shell
7
star
24

riscv64-multiplatform

Shell
6
star
25

linux-next

Shell
5
star
26

armv7_devel

Multi Kernel trees
Shell
4
star
27

bertos

mirror of http://www.bertos.org/
C
4
star
28

barebox-boards

mirror of: git://git.pengutronix.de/git/barebox.git + board stuff...
C
4
star
29

shamrock

C
4
star
30

rscm

Really Simple Cape Manager
Shell
4
star
31

IoTFuse-2018-ESP32-Atmosphere

3
star
32

flasher

Nand Re-Flash Script
Shell
3
star
33

media-ctl

mirror of: http://git.ideasonboard.org/media-ctl.git
C
3
star
34

elftosb

C++
3
star
35

project-rootstock

Retired: replace by RootStock-NG.sh in: https://github.com/RobertCNelson/omap-image-builder
Shell
3
star
36

pkg-chromium

Shell
2
star
37

meta-beagleboard-kernel

BitBake
2
star
38

omap2plus-mainline-linux

2
star
39

xf86-video-armada

C
2
star
40

u-boot-boards

wip board patches
C
2
star
41

am33x-cm3

mirror of: am33x-cm3.git
C
2
star
42

cross-compiler

Shell
2
star
43

pandaboard-docs

2
star
44

arm64-multiplatform

1
star
45

beagleboard.org-kernel

1
star
46

imx-linux-kernel-dev

verndor bsp...
1
star
47

accordion-block

JavaScript
1
star
48

imx_v6_v7-mainline-linux

1
star
49

entitools

1
star
50

socfpga-kernel-dev

1
star
51

Supercon-2018

1
star
52

rockchip-linux-dev

1
star
53

bisector

Shell
1
star
54

linaro-tools

Shell
1
star
55

fedora-media-builder

Fedora Media Builder
Shell
1
star
56

bb-bbai-firmware

1
star
57

bb-wl18xx-firmware

1
star
58

eewiki

1
star
59

arm64-mainline-linux

Shell
1
star
60

xf86-video-omap

mirror: http://cgit.freedesktop.org/xorg/driver/xf86-video-omap/
C
1
star
61

ti-uim

mirror of: http://gitorious.org/uim
C
1
star
62

multi_v7-mainline-linux

1
star
63

debian-u-boot

C
1
star
64

yavta

mirror of: http://git.ideasonboard.org/yavta.git
C
1
star